Output 8c26279db1f971125b2695130ad60ef14a0cef91a2006977fa479862e41dd838:0

value
6562146496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c29512e9fa8ecf64f1e563b088e1bd79a17dd5e OP_EQUAL
address
MR44mFv4oeJQQWGhuJ7bGu5m21hLjWCf4t
transaction
8c26279db1f971125b2695130ad60ef14a0cef91a2006977fa479862e41dd838
spent
true